What Is CPM and Why Does It Matter?
CPM stands for “Cost Per Mille,” where “mille” refers to one thousand impressions. This model is especially common in display advertising, programmatic ads, and brand awareness campaigns. How a CPM Calculator ClickZ Works
A CPM calculator typically uses a simple formula:
CPM = (Total Cost ÷ Total Impressions) × 1,000
